[media] v4l2-dv-timings: fix rounding in hblank and hsync calculation
Browse files Browse the repository at this point in the history
Changed the rounding calculation for hblank and hsync to match it
to equations in cvt and gtf standards.

In cvt calculation, hsync needs to be rounded down.

In gtf calculations, hblank needs to be rounded to nearest multiple
of twice the cell granularity and hsync needs to be rounded to the
nearest multiple of cell granularity.
